Book cover of Historical Atlas of Mormonism
by Cannon, George Q., Brown
Language: English
Release Date: January 1, 1994

A comprehensive reference source explores the impact of Mormonism on America, especially on the settling of the West. This atlas offers seventy-four sections, each with maps, that describe migration routes, missions centers, population distribution, and much more.
